While some people are more naturally inclined to seek out leadership roles than others, it’s possible for anyone to grow into a leader.

Leadership fundamentally starts with yourself, your experiences, and how you’ve led yourself through life’s ups and downs. Good leaders know how to pick themselves back up after a challenge; they’re resilient.

The challenges I’ve faced again and again as a result of living with a disability have actually become something of a leadership superpower, because they’ve made me incredibly resilient. Today, I want to talk about why resilience is about more than bouncing back, how my experiences have helped me lead myself and others, and my vision for helping other women with disabilities elevate themselves into leadership.
